/// Interface for accessing OpenSearchServerless
///
/// Use the Amazon OpenSearch Serverless API to create, configure, and manage OpenSearch
/// Serverless collections and security policies.
///
///
///
/// OpenSearch Serverless is an on-demand, pre-provisioned serverless configuration for
/// Amazon OpenSearch Service. OpenSearch Serverless removes the operational complexities
/// of provisioning, configuring, and tuning your OpenSearch clusters. It enables you
/// to easily search and analyze petabytes of data without having to worry about the underlying
/// infrastructure and data management.
